In 2024, Sri Lanka secured their first Women’s Asia Cup title win, beating India with a clinical run-chase in front of home fans. This was also just the second time in their nine final appearances that India failed to win the Women’s Asia Cup. Samarawickrama was the Player of the Match in the Final, while Chamari Athapaththu was the Player of the Tournament for her 304 runs and three wickets in the event.

Women’s Asia Cup Winners List 2004 to 2024

The Women’s Asia Cup has been a cornerstone of women’s cricket in Asia since its inception in 2004. This tournament has showcased the evolving landscape of women’s cricket in the region, with India dominating for much of its history, but also featuring breakthrough performances from other nations.

Asia Cup Winners List from 2004 to 2024
YEAR FORMAT WINNER WON BY RUNNER UP VENUE
2024 T20I Sri Lanka 8 wickets India Dambulla
2022 T20I India 8 Wickets Sri Lanka Sylhet
2018 T20I Bangladesh 3 Wickets India Kuala Lumpur
2016 T20I India 17 Runs Pakistan Bangkok
2012 T20I India 18 Runs Pakistan Guangzhou
2008 ODI India 177 Runs Sri Lanka Kurunegala
2006 ODI India 8 Wickets Sri Lanka Jaipur
2005-06 ODI India 97 Runs Sri Lanka Karachi
2004 ODI India Tournament 5–0 Sri Lanka Colombo
